About IIHMR University :

IIHMR University is a premier institution offering specialized education in the fields of health and hospital management, pharmaceutical management, public health, and healthcare analytics. The university provides a range of postgraduate programs, including MBA (Hospital and Health Management), MBA (Pharmaceutical Management), MBA (Development Management), MBA (Healthcare Analytics), Master of Public Health (in collaboration with Johns Hopkins University, USA), Executive Education, and Ph.D. programs.

Position : Counsellor – MPH (Johns Hopkins University Cooperative Program)

Role Overview : The Counsellor – MPH (JHU Cooperative Program) will be responsible for promoting, counselling, and facilitating admissions for the prestigious Master of Public Health (MPH) program offered in collaboration with Johns Hopkins University, USA. The role involves engaging with prospective students across India and SAARC countries, providing end-to-end guidance throughout the admission process, and ensuring a seamless experience in alignment with international academic standards.

Qualification : Master’s degree in public health, Marketing, International Education, or related field.

Required Skills :

  • Excellent communication, presentation, and interpersonal skills.
  • Familiarity with global education systems, international admission platforms (e.g., SOPHAS), and credential evaluation processes.
  • Proficiency in MS Office and CRM tools.
  • Culturally sensitive, detail-oriented, and capable of managing multiple leads simultaneously.
  • Willingness to travel occasionally for outreach and recruitment activities.
  • Strategic thinker with a result-oriented approach.
  • Strong organizational and project management skills.
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ively with international partners.

Required Experience : 2–5 years of relevant experience in student counselling, international education, or global admissions.

Key Responsibilities :

  • Counsel prospective students and working professionals about the IIHMRU–JHU MPH program, its structure, eligibility, and global career prospects.
  • Manage enquiries through inbound and outbound calls, emails, and online platforms.
  • Guide applicants through the entire admission process, including eligibility verification, documentation, and application submission via global portals (e.g., SOPHAS).
  • Support candidates in preparing Statements of Purpose (SOPs), credential evaluations (WES / ECE), and other international requirements.
  • Maintain accurate and updated records of enquiries, leads, and conversions through the CRM system.
  • Collaborate with the academic and marketing teams to plan and execute student recruitment and outreach strategies.
  • Assist in organizing and participating in webinars, educational fairs, campus visits, and virtual information sessions.
  • Track and analyze admission trends, conversion ratios, and provide regular reports to the Admissions Head.
  • Ensure timely communication with Johns Hopkins University counterparts for applicant coordination and program updates.
